France and Germany Scrap Fighter Jet Project, Impacting European Defence Cooperation

France and Germany have officially decided to terminate their joint fighter jet development project, marking a significant setback to European defence cooperation efforts. The project, initially envisioned as a flagship initiative to boost European military autonomy, has faced numerous hurdles leading to its collapse.

This decision comes at a time when the United States intensifies its call for Europe to enhance its military independence. Washington’s push aims to encourage European nations to strengthen their defense capabilities and reduce reliance on American military support.

The Franco-German fighter jet project represented a strategic attempt to integrate defense technologies and consolidate military strength within the European Union framework. Originally, it promised to foster closer defence collaboration between the two leading European powers and position Europe as a more self-sufficient military actor on the global stage.

However, differences in national interests, budget constraints, and technical challenges plagued the project from the outset. Debates over design specifications, funding priorities, and industrial participation led to delays and disagreements. These issues eroded mutual trust and ultimately forced both governments to abandon the plan.

The scrapping of the fighter jet initiative casts doubt on the future of European defence integration, which has sought to create a coherent military capability pool across member states. It highlights persistent obstacles such as varying defence policies, divergent strategic priorities, and competing domestic industries that hinder deeper cooperation.

Analysts note that the failure may prompt European countries to reconsider their defence collaboration strategies, potentially leading to more fragmented and less ambitious projects. This could undermine the EU’s capacity to act independently in global security matters, increasing reliance on NATO and the United States.

The U.S. perspective emphasizes encouragement for Europeans to modernize and unify their defence posture, thereby sharing the burden of global security more equitably. Washington views a militarily weaker Europe as a strategic vulnerability and seeks to promote initiatives that strengthen transatlantic collaboration.

Despite the setback, some officials remain optimistic about future projects and the commitment to European defence. They suggest that lessons learned from the failed fighter jet program could inform better coordination, clearer goal setting, and stronger political will in upcoming initiatives.

The end of the France-Germany fighter jet project serves as a cautionary tale of the complexities involved in multinational defence projects. It underscores the need for alignment of political, economic, and strategic interests to achieve meaningful progress in European military integration.

In conclusion, the termination of the joint fighter jet plan between France and Germany delivers a blow to the vision of a united European defense front. As pressures mount from the United States for Europe to stand stronger militarily, the continent faces critical choices about how to navigate its defence future amidst diverging national agendas and global security challenges.
